St. Louis is going to build a new football stadium funded by taxpayer money so the Rams won't move to Los Angeles.

non-meme answer: because the NFL (and most other pro sports in the US) is so immensely powerful that billionaire owners can cuck entire major cities in America and demand they build million dollar stadiums for their team to play in, or else they will leave and find another city to build their stadium because everyone is desperate for professional sports in America

Yes but England is a very different country and this is at a much larger scale to here.

Usually a council will only chip in with a loan, or some subsidies OR in a few cases paying for the stadium, leasing it back but getting use out of it themselves (e.g Man City's council house)

>>64553548
You literally don't know what you're talking about.

Owners have to maintain the stadium out of pocket, pay rental fees, and in many cases, partially fund the stadium.

One of the reasons Art Modell moved the Browns to Baltimore was because the Clevland's stadium was an old piece of shit that Modell lost millions having to maintain because the city didn't do shit.

Its sports. The richest team in baseball.the yankees, asked for and got 450 million to finish their stadium from taxpayers then turned around and a month later spent 450 million on 3 new player contracts.
It happens everywhere.

Ford Field was funded entirely by the Ford family. Not one cent of taxpayer money was used.

Comerica Park and the other new stadium for the Red Wings is owned and funded for by the city. Hell, Comerica had to pay 66 million just for the naming rights to a stadium they don't own.
